Industry Analysis
NVIDIA and Hyundai’s deepened alliance marks a pivotal shift from theoretical physical AI to scalable deployment. Technically, Alpamayo’s reasoning-based architecture accelerates sensor fusion innovation—especially between LiDAR and 4D radar—and intensifies demand for 3nm automotive-grade chips, directly benefiting TSMC’s (Taiwan, China) EUV capacity allocation. Regulatory headwinds loom: stricter EU/US mandates on localized AI training data will inflate compliance costs for their planned AI factories in Germany and the U.S. Competitors like Tesla and Mobileye will likely fast-track end-to-end autonomous stacks in response. Meanwhile, Chinese firms such as Horizon Robotics may double down on partnerships with state-backed automakers. Within 18 months, the ‘AI factory + vehicle manufacturing’ integrated model will become a new industry barrier, sidelining Tier 1 suppliers lacking vertical integration.
